EMBLEM SIGNUM POLONICUM
The emblem of Polish Martial Arts Signum Polonicum is represented by a White Eagle, Erne, with its head turned right, its wings made of white-and-red flag resting on St. Maurice’s spear from the right and Polish great scythe from the left.
Erne’s torso is created from the almond shaped shield with two knight’s crosses, the “Szczerbiec” great sword inside and in the lower part crossed insignia of hetman’s power, truncheon and ceremonial mace . The shield is lined on both sides by two sabres – hussar sabre and Polish open grip combat sabre of “karabela” type.
